How Does Kier’s Merger Impact BIM Coordination in Infrastructure Projects?

Kier’s decision to merge its divisions into a single infrastructure behemoth is a game-changer for BIM professionals working on highways, railways, and urban developments. Previously, siloed teams often led to version control issues and delayed approvals, costing projects up to 20% in overruns according to industry reports from the Construction Industry Institute. Now, with James Askew at the helm, the firm aims for a unified approach that integrates BIM tools across the board.

Imagine a scenario where a highway project involves civil engineers from one division and MEP specialists from another. Before the merger, incompatible software versions could cause clashes in Revit models, leading to rework. Post-merger, Kier’s streamlined structure allows for standardized BIM protocols, potentially cutting coordination time by 30%. This benefits engineers by enabling real-time collaboration via cloud-based platforms like Autodesk BIM 360, transforming disjointed processes into cohesive workflows. For instance, a recent Kier project in the UK saw a 25% reduction in clashes after adopting integrated BIM standards, proving that such mergers can turn potential bottlenecks into productivity boosts.

How Can You Prepare for BIM Changes in Industry Mergers?

To thrive in this evolving landscape, start by auditing your current BIM workflows for merger-readiness. Kier’s move highlights the importance of adaptable tools that support large-scale integrations. Begin with a gap analysis: Compare your team’s software stack against industry leaders like Autodesk or Bentley Systems to identify upgrades needed for seamless collaboration.

For actionable steps, focus on cloud migration and training. Implement platforms that facilitate remote access, as Kier’s infrastructure projects often span multiple sites. By doing so, you can replicate their success—studies from McKinsey show that digital twins in merged operations improve project delivery by 15-20%.
